"Não Há Dinheiro" is a standout collaborative track between the folk-inspired and the comedic character Rouxinol Faduncho (created by Portuguese comedian Marco Horácio). Released in 2012 as part of the album Formidável Bigode , the song blends traditional sounds with social commentary through humor. 🎵 Origin & Meaning

The song is a remake of an original 1997 track by Sebastião Antunes and his band .
Rouxinol Faduncho revitalized the track for a new generation, using its popular folk roots to highlight that, even 20 years later, the economic struggle remained unchanged.
